Are Hammerhead Worms Toxic. Hammerhead worms are poisonous, invasive flatworms that can reproduce by fragmentation. Hammerhead worms are flatworms that produce a neurotoxin in their mucus. And they’ve been hiding in plain sight in the us for a long time. They can be harmful to humans and pets if ingested or touched, but they are not aggressive or bite. Hammerhead worms are carnivorous, predatory flatworms that can produce a poison similar to puffer fish. Hammerhead worms are flatworms that can secrete a toxin to paralyze and eat other soil animals.
